        Larry Ness:

        It's probably not possible to pit two teams featuring more divergent styles than Tex Tech and Navy. The Red Raiders are a scoring machine with BJ Symons setting an NCAA single-season record for passing yards along with throwing 48 TD passes. Navy led the nation in rushing with a mind-boggling average of 326.1 ypg, as QB Craig Candeto ran and passed for more than 1000 yards, FB Kyle Eckel ran for almost 1200 yards and RBs Lane and Roberts averaged 13.2 and 9.3 ypc respectively! Tex Tech allowed almost 36 ppg on defense and it seems impossible to believe that they will stop Navy's option. As for Navy, this year's defense allowed almost 100 ypg less than last year's unit as well as allowing 15 ppg less! Against the pass in 2003 Navy allowed just 154 ypg and only NINE TD passes but they've never faced an offense like this. While Tex Tech has been a bowl regular the last decade going to eight bowls, they've won just TWICE! For Navy, 3-30 the previous three seasons, this year's 8-4 team has the Midshipmen in a bowl game for the first time since 1996! Navy ended the year with SEVEN straight ATS wins and has covered FOURTEEN of its last 17 games! 10* Navy.

        Big Al McMordie:

        The Cougars were upset by in-state rival Washington in their last game, and off that upset loss, Washington St. falls into a super College Bowl system of mine that is 27-4 ATS since 1980, including 1-0 already this season with Memphis over North Texas. This system involves playing on certain Underdogs that lost outright as a Favorite in their last regular season game, provided they weren't favored by more than 10.5 in their last regular season game. There's one other parameter that makes this system pop to 27-4 ATS (which will remain for my eyes only), and we can improve our 27-4 stat to a perfect 14-0 ATS if our opponent (here, Texas) is off a double-digit win. With the Longhorns indeed off a blowout 46-15 win over Texas Tech, let's take Washington State tonight as a 4* Play. Good luck, as always...Al McMordie.
